Saving a dying world from otherworldly monsters and unknown infection was the only thing he and his fellow Operators knew. If it took dying as many times as necessary to accomplish, then let the gates of hell part open. The war shall continue.

•    -    •

After the first portal opened, the world had changed drastically. Monsters called the Walkers roamed the surface while infective plants grew on their soil, rendering everything uninhabitable. Civilization took a heavy blow as a result; technology has been lost, animal and plant life have gone almost extinct, and the world is a crueler place than ever before.

The only safe place that remains is the Concrete Eden; a massive fortress situated underground where the last bastion of humanity reside and prepare to fight the infection. Men, women and children each play their role to scrap by and keep their home running, while a secret task force aptly termed the Operators are sent out on high-risk missions against the Husks.

Ace, the first Operator and the leader of its group, sees no future worth fighting for. It's not the first time he's fought, and he doubted it would end any time soon. Even so, it was his duty to keep trying. And try he will-even if meant dying over and over again. At least he'll get as many tries as necessary, he supposed...
